  • 摘要:Hadoop is popular framework for storing and processing big data in cloud computing. Map-Reduce and HDFSare the two major components of Hadoop. Map reduce is programming model for Hadoop and HDFS is a Hadoopdistributed file system which is mainly used as storage component for Hadoop framework. Existing Hadoop system hasmany performance issues like serialization barrier, repetitive merges, portability issues for different interconnects. Aneffective and efficient I/O capability is also required for Hadoop. As data size is increasing day by day the performance ofHadoop is becoming a critical issue. To handle large dataset needs to improve the performance by modifying existingHadoop system. The network levitated merge algorithm is used to avoid repetitive merges. A full pipeline is designed tooverlap the Hadoop shuffle merge and reduce phase. Hadoop-A i.e. Hadoop Acceleration framework overcomes theportability issue for different interconnects. It also speeds up data movement and also reduces the disk access
